College Grants or Scholarships in America for being of Polish decent.



Diane   May 2, 07, 21:07 /  #
Hi, I was born in the U.S and my parents are both from Poland. I was wondering if there are any college grants of scholarships here in America for people who are of Polish decent. We dont have any Polish kids at my school, and my counselors can't find anything either.
